These 19 stocks turned into tenbaggers in 5 years: Peter Lynch’s rules to find the next

·Economic Times·Impact 2/5 · Moderate

Indian stocks have seen remarkable growth over the last five years, with some companies experiencing tenbagger returns. These extraordinary gains include GE Vernova T&D and BSE shares, which soared by over two thousand percent. This growth is also evident in Apar Industries and Zen Technologies, which have reported impressive results. According to Peter Lynch, understanding your investments and maintaining them for the long haul can lead to fruitful results, suggesting that patience and a long-term perspective are key to successful investing.
